It took me two days to get to Houston, a long journey from my small mountain town to the 47th annual NCECA conference, but I am extremely grateful to be here.
NCECA is an opportunity to be immersed and inspired by all things ceramic. Whenever I have the opportunity to attend I am amazed by the diversity of work produced from such a humble material. It is not only the diversity of work but as I listen to discussions and presentations I am reminded of each artists unique journey and learning process with the material.
I ended my afternoon at the "Emerging" Trend in Professional Development discussion by the 2013 emerging artists: Lindsay Pichaske, Sunchine Cobb, Lauren Gallaspy, Linda Swanson, Amber Ginsberg and Brain R. Jones. Although there was commonalities in their ceramic trajectories and the routes to which led them to be leading the discussion this afternoon, there was an inspiring uniqueness in their experience. This individuality is apparent in their work as well, each responding to contemporary life through ceramics with a strong personal voice.

It was a real pleasure to experience the work of these artists in person. I felt moved and silenced in a bustling environment with the quality of sensuality through texture and sensitivity to the material that is impossible to grasp through images. The work of each of these artists spoke to me of the layered complexity of experience.
